Marion brings small-town ease together with daily convenience, set amid woods, farm fields, and the slow bend of the Embarrass River. Residents enjoy quick connections to Clintonville and Waupaca, while life in town revolves around local parks, youth sports, and seasonal events supported by a close-knit volunteer base. City services and community updates are easy to track through the City of Marion website, and outdoor fans head a short drive south to hike, bird, ski, and snowshoe at the expansive Navarino Wildlife Area. Summer afternoons often turn into lake days at nearby Hartman Creek State Park, a favorite for swimming beaches, paddling, and the Ice Age Trail segment.
Families value strong local schools; the Marion School District blends hands-on learning with ag-tech, trades, and small class sizes. Book lovers make regular stops at the Marion Public Library, part of the regional InfoSoup system with robust digital collections. Healthcare is close at hand through ThedaCare Medical Center–Shawano, while weekend explorers discover regional history at the innovative FWD Seagrave Museum in Shawano County. Marion also spans Waupaca County, giving residents access to a wide range of county services, trails, and lakes.
